A local forum buddy of mine's '95 started having some issues and he included a video of the car running. Any thoughts?

My 1995 Nissan Maxima broke down on me this morning. I was driving down the highway around 70mph and all of a sudden the car died while going down the road. I pulled over and it would not start back up right away, while I was waiting on the tow truck, after about 20 minutes of sitting I tried starting it and it started but it is making some loud noises on the passenger side engine area. Sounded like a pretty loud squeeky noise and a little grumbling sound. I turned it off right away and have not tried starting it since as I don't want to possibly do anymore damage to the car than has already happened.
